Neighbourhoods for Life - Designing dementia-friendly outdoor environments

A finding leaflet by Oxford Centre for Sustainable Development (2004). The study aimed to find out how to create dementia friendly neighbourhoods that enhance and extend the active participation of older people with dementia in their local communities. The objectives of the study were as follows:

  • To investigate how older people with dementia interact with the outdoor environment, the nature and quality of their experiences, and their understanding of the outdoor environment
  • To identify design factors that influence the ability of older people with dementia to successfully use the outdoor environment
  • To offer preliminary guidance (at all scales, from urban design to the design of street furniture) for designing dementia-friendly outdoor environments
